Virtual Local Area Networks (VLANs) are a fundamental component of network security, allowing organizations to segment their networks and isolate sensitive data. This segmentation can be particularly effective in defending against ransomware attacks, which often spread rapidly across unsegmented networks.

Understanding VLANs and Ransomware

VLANs work by dividing a physical network into multiple logical networks. Each VLAN acts as a separate subnet, which can restrict the movement of malicious software like ransomware. When properly configured, VLANs limit an attacker's ability to move laterally within a network, reducing the risk of widespread infection.

How VLAN Security Enhances Ransomware Defense

  • Network Segmentation: VLANs isolate critical systems from general user devices, preventing ransomware from spreading easily.
  • Access Control: Proper VLAN configuration enforces strict access policies, ensuring only authorized devices can communicate within sensitive segments.
  • Traffic Monitoring: Segmented VLANs facilitate better monitoring and detection of unusual activity indicative of ransomware presence.
  • Reduced Attack Surface: By limiting network exposure, VLANs decrease the number of potential entry points for attackers.

Limitations and Best Practices

While VLANs are effective, they are not a standalone solution. Attackers can still exploit vulnerabilities if VLANs are misconfigured or if there is poor network management. To maximize security, organizations should combine VLANs with other measures such as firewalls, intrusion detection systems, and regular security audits.
